(*)Practical, on-hands courses are held in form of a "Journal Club" in which each student is required to present a selected, recent research paper on each topic in the course as if the paper were his or her own paper. This means student must defend the paper during a discussion with fellow classmates and instructors. These types of courses have been designed to teach students the art of critical reading/understanding as well as practice presentation techniques when presenting one's own research work. The Journal Club will be open to all other students in the department as a source of understanding in field of molecular and cellular biology.
